The Republican Socio-Political Movement Equality (Mişcare Social-Politică Republicană Ravnopravie) is a left-of-centre political party in Moldova. At the legislative election, on 6 March 2005, the party won 3.8% of the popular vote, but no seats. The party's political program seems to indicate a pro-Russian stance in relation to foreign policy, as the opening paragraphs of the document make the claim that "quality of life of citizens" was superior under the Soviet Union[1] and that Moldova's socio-economic problems relate to Moldova's negative relationship with the Russian Federation.
